Treatment Services for the Hearing Impaired - Alcohol and Drug Treatment Programs - Grasonville, MD.

Drug treatment services for the hearing impaired are offered in both an outpatient and inpatient basis. People with hearing impairment can be at a greater risk of substance abuse problems as a result of their disability. Having a major impairment can be a source of discouragement, depression and apathy for both adults and adolescents who could easily turn to drugs or alcohol to cope with these feelings. Hearing impaired treatment services are accessible in Grasonville to help resolve addiction for these clients, with ASL and other assistance which provides recovery and treatment information and education in writing so that patients aren't hindered from receiving help because of their handicap.

Drug and alcohol rehabilitation facilities that have full time staff to provide assistance for the hearing impaired are the most ideal programs to consider. Some facilities may only have part-time staff to interpret and assist hearing impaired clients, which this means hearing impaired clients won't benefit as much as everyone else and will miss out on essential activities they should be attending daily. There may be video presentations available which use sign language as well, which can also be extremely helpful.

There are organizations and agencies that supply hearing impaired people struggling with substance abuse issues with resources and information to discover and locate the treatment services they need. One is the Deaf Off Drugs and Alcohol (DODA).
